DESCRIPTION
The ADS1224 is a 4-channel, 24-bit, delta-sigma analog-to-digital (A/D) converter. It offers excellent performance and low power in a TSSOP-20 package. The
ADS1224 is well-suited for demanding, high-resolution
measurements, especially in portable systems and other space-saving and power-constrained applications.
A delta-sigma (∆Σ) modulator and digital filter form the
basis of the A/D converter. The analog modulator has
a ±5V differential input range. An input multiplexer
(MUX) is used to select between four separate
differential input channels. A buffer can be selected to
increase the input impedance of the measurement.
A simple, 2-wire serial interface provides all the
necessary control. Data retrieval, self-calibration, and
Standby mode are handled with a few simple
waveforms. When only single conversions are needed,
the ADS1224 can be quickly shut down (Standby mode)
while idle between measurements to dramatically
reduce the overall power consumption. Multiple
ADS1224s can be connected together to create a
synchronously sampling multichannel measurement
system. The ADS1224 is designed to easily connect to
microcontrollers, such as the MSP430.
The ADS1224 supports 2.7V to 5.5V analog supplies
and 2.7V to 5.5V digital supplies. Power is typically less
than 1mW in 3V operation and less than 1µW during
Standby mode.
